# Timeout for individual WebSocket send operations (seconds)
# Prevents a slow client from blocking broadcasts to other clients
SEND_TIMEOUT_SECONDS = 5.0
class WebSocketManager:
"""Manages WebSocket connections and broadcasts events."""

async def broadcast(self, event_type: str, data: Any) -> None:
"""Broadcast an event to all connected clients."""
"""Broadcast an event to all connected clients.
Uses a copy-then-send pattern to avoid holding the lock during I/O:
1. Copy connection list while holding lock
2. Release lock before sending
3. Send to all clients concurrently with timeout
4. Re-acquire lock to clean up disconnected clients
"""
